ALGEBRA I @ SECTION 1 -1 : VARIABLES and EXPRESSIONS
NUMERICAL EXPRESSION : A statement that contains only numbers and mathematical operations (6 + 2 ÷ 4). More examples : VARIABLE : A symbol that stands for a number. For x – 5 = 8, what is the variable? ANSWER : x ALGEBRAIC EXPRESSION : A statement that contains numbers, variables, and mathematical operations (45 n, 3 x – 5). More examples :
EQUATION : A sentence that contains an equals sign (5 x + 3 = 12). More examples : ADDITION plus more than the sum of increased by added to the total of in all gain SUBTRACTION minus less than** the difference of decreased by subtracted from** fewer than** descend deflate
MULTIPLICATION the product of multiplied by times twice/thrice of powers area/volume double/triple DIVISION the quotient of divided by the ratio of half per goes into out of EXPONENTS squared cubed to the _____ power
Write an algebraic expression for each word phrase. 1) x minus five ANSWER : x - 5 2) x less than five ANSWER : 5 - x 3) y cubed ANSWER : y 3 4) half of x increased by eight ANSWER : (1/2)x + 8 5) the quotient of y and seven ANSWER : y ÷ 7
Write a word phrase for each algebraic expression. 6) 5 m 6 Possible Answer : The product of five and m to the sixth power. 7) Possible Answer : The product of one-third and x squared.
8) 4 x – 5 x 2 Possible Answer : The difference of the product of four and x and the product of five and x squared. 9) y 2 + 17 Possible Answer : The sum of y squared and seventeen.
Write an equation for each sentence. 10) The quotient of t and eight is equal to twenty. Possible Answer : t ÷ 8 = 20 11) Seven less than the product of three and g is thirty-one Possible Answer : 3 g – 7 = 31
Write a sentence for each equation. 12) j + 4 = 21 Possible Answer : The sum of j and four is equal to twenty-one. 13) 3 z – 12 = 15 Possible Answer : The product of three and z decreased by twelve is equal to fifteen.
